Inter-brain synchrony between undergraduate students during a naturalistic online seminar predicted greater relational satisfaction and task performance
As higher education increasingly transitions to online platforms such as Zoom, understanding the mechanisms that underlie effective virtual collaboration has become essential. Prior research has shown that relational quality, trust, and communication strongly influence online collaborative learning; however, the real-time cognitive and affective dynamics underpinning these interactions are yet to be elucidated.
